2001 Chevrolet Tracker vs. 2007 Fiat Stilo

To start off, 2007 Fiat Stilo is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Chevrolet Tracker.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Chevrolet Tracker would be higher. At 1,999 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 Chevrolet Tracker is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Chevrolet Tracker (127 HP) has 25 more horse power than 2007 Fiat Stilo. (102 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2001 Chevrolet Tracker should accelerate faster than 2007 Fiat Stilo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Fiat Stilo weights approximately 183 kg more than 2001 Chevrolet Tracker.

Because 2001 Chevrolet Tracker is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2007 Fiat Stilo.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Chevrolet Tracker will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Chevrolet Tracker (183 Nm) has 38 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Fiat Stilo. (145 Nm). This means 2001 Chevrolet Tracker will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Fiat Stilo.
